TELECOM CENTRAL LIMITED AND SUBSIDIARY
NOTES TO THE FINANCIAL STATEMENTS
(CONTINUED)
10 SHAREHOLDERS' EQUITY
SHARE PREMIUM RESERVE
| 1992 | 1991 | |
|---|---|---|
| $000's | $000's | |
| Balance at beginning of year | 419,058 | 206,359 |
| (consisting of a premium of $9,999 on 41,910 redeemable preference shares) | ||
| Balance from acquired subsidiary | - | 212,699 |
| (consisting of a premium of $9,999 on 21,272 redeemable preference shares) | ||
| Movements during year: | ||
| -Dividend declared | (212,699) | |
| -Premium of $9,999 on 4,000 redeemable preference shares | 39,996 | |
| -Premium of $9,999 on 21,272 redeemable preference shares | - | 212,699 |
| 459,054 | 419,058 |
Dividends declared apply to redeemable preference shares as if they were ordinary shares. On winding up of the company preference shareholders rank in priority to ordinary shareholders in respect of outstanding dividends and the issue price of the redeemable preference shares. The redeemable preference shares are subject to redemption, at the issue price five days after written notice from the holder.
RETAINED EARNINGS
| 1992 | 1991 | |
|---|---|---|
| $000's | $000's | |
| Balance at beginning of year | 15,741 | 9,251 |
| Balance from acquired subsidiary | - | 12,152 |
| Net earnings | 76,178 | 62,354 |
| 91,919 | 83,757 | |
| Dividends | (59,045) | (68,016) |
| Balance at end of year | 32,874 | 15,741 |
DIVIDENDS
Interim and final dividends declared from the retained earnings of the Company are as follows:
| 1992 | 1991 | |
|---|---|---|
| $000's | $000's | |
| Interim dividends | 59,045 | 34,295 |
| Final dividend | - | 33,721 |
| 59,045 | 68,016 |
